14 Laravel Tips in 12 Minutes: January 2025

  • Verwende 'chunk by ID' und 'update' für schnellere Datenaktualisierungen.
  • Verwende HTTP-Makros für wiederholende HTTP-Anfragen.
  • Verwende Beobachter, um den Cache zu löschen, wenn Daten in der Datenbank geändert werden.
  • Verwende Datenübertragungsobjekte (DTOs) für komplexe Strukturen und Validierung.
  • Beschränke bestimmte Artisan-Befehle auf dem Produktionsserver.
  • Sei kreativ mit Faker-Regeln für realistischere Tests.
  • Verwende den Laravel-Validator nicht nur in Controllern und Formularanfragen.
  • Aktualisiere Felder in Pivot-Tabellen mit 'updateExistingPivot'.
  • Passe die E-Mail zur Überprüfung nach der Registrierung an.
  • Verwende PHP-Traits, um größere Funktionalitäten aus deinem Hauptmodell auszulagern.
  • Verwende Queue-Jobs für zeitaufwändige Aufgaben.
  • Erstelle wiederverwendbare Funktionen für gruppierte Datenberechnungen.
  • Lese den Artikel von Vincent Bean über das Skalieren von PHP-Anwendungen.
  • Nutze das Beispiel für eine E-Commerce-Datenbankstruktur von Laravel Daily.

via 14 Laravel Tips in 12 Minutes: January 2025